Современный торговый процесс невозможен без автоматизации, и центральным элементом этой системы становится связка между кассовым оборудованием и учетной системой. Когда предприниматели и бухгалтеры ищут информацию о том, как выгрузить данные из камина в 1С, они часто путают терминологию, имея в виду работу с фискальным накопителем или настройку обмена данными с веб-ресурсом. На самом деле, речь идет о сложном процессе синхронизации, который включает в себя регистрацию ККТ, настройку драйверов и корректный обмен документами купли-продажи.

Некорректная настройка этого узла может привести к тому, что продажи не будут отражаться в учете, а фискальные данные не попадут в налоговую службу вовремя. Это создает риски штрафов со стороны контролирующих органов и хаоса в складском учете. Важно понимать, что «камин» в данном контексте — это сленговое или ошибочное название Контрольно-Кассовой Техники (ККТ), которая требует постоянного внимания администратора системы.

В этой статье мы подробно разберем все этапы интеграции: от физического подключения устройства до программной настройки обмена данными через веб-сервисы. Вы узнаете, какие драйверы необходимы, как проверить статус фискализации и что делать, если данные «зависли» в очереди на отправку. Правильная организация этого процесса — залог прозрачности вашего бизнеса и спокойствия перед проверками.

Подготовка оборудования и установка драйверов

Первым шагом на пути к успешной интеграции является физическое подключение кассового аппарата к компьютеру, на котором запущена 1С. Большинство современных моделей, таких как Атол, Штрих-М или Viki Print, подключаются через интерфейс USB, хотя некоторые конфигурации могут требовать использования COM-порта или сети Ethernet. Прежде чем запускать программное обеспечение, необходимо убедиться, что операционная система видит устройство и установила для него базовые драйверы.

Для корректной работы 1С с кассой требуется установка специализированного драйвера ККТ. Это промежуточное программное обеспечение, которое транслирует команды из учетной системы на язык, понятный кассовому аппарату. Без этого компонента 1С просто не «увидит» подключенное оборудование. Обычно дистрибутив драйвера поставляется на диске вместе с кассой или доступен для скачивания на сайте производителя.

⚠️ Внимание: Версия драйвера ККТ должна строго соответствовать версии платформы 1С и конфигурации вашей базы данных. Использование устаревшего драйвера с новой версией 1С часто приводит к ошибкам инициализации оборудования.

Процесс установки обычно стандартен: запускаете инсталлятор, соглашаетесь с лицензией и выбираете тип подключения. Если вы используете сетевую кассу, потребуется ввести IP-адрес устройства и номер порта. После установки драйвера рекомендуется запустить тестовую печать чека через утилиту «Тест связи», чтобы убедиться в стабильности соединения перед началом работы с базой 1С.

Особое внимание следует уделить правам доступа. Пользователь, под которым запускается 1С, должен иметь права на чтение и запись в порты устройства. В корпоративных сетях с жесткой политикой безопасности это часто становится камнем преткновения, и администратору приходится вручную прописывать разрешения в реестре или групповых политиках.

Регистрация ККТ и настройка в 1С

После того как «железо» готово к работе, необходимо зарегистрировать кассу в личном кабинете Федеральной налоговой службы и получить регистрационный номер. Этот номер, а также номер фискального накопителя, нужно будет ввести в карточку оборудования внутри 1С. Процесс настройки в самой программе зависит от используемой конфигурации: «Управление торговлей», «Розница» или «Бухгалтерия предприятия».

В типовой конфигурации 1С для настройки ККТ необходимо перейти в раздел НСИ и администрирование → Оборудование → Кассы ККМ. Здесь создается новый элемент справочника, где указываются наименование кассы, ее тип и место установки. Критически важно правильно выбрать модель из выпадающего списка, так как от этого зависит набор доступных функций и команд.

  • 🖥️ Выберите тип подключения: локальный порт (USB/COM) или TCP/IP для сетевых касс.
  • 🔢 Введите регистрационный номер РНМ, полученный в ФНС, и заводской номер корпуса.
  • 💾 Укажите путь к файлу лицензии или ключу защиты, если используется платный модуль интеграции.
  • 🏷️ Присвойте кассе понятное имя, например, «Касса №1 (Основной зал)», чтобы не путаться при выборе в чеках.

Следующим этапом является настройка параметров фискализации. В карточке кассы необходимо указать систему налогообложения, которая будет применяться по умолчанию при пробитии чеков. Ошибка в этом параметре приведет к тому, что в фискальный документ попадет неверная ставка налога, что потребует сложной процедуры коррекции через чек коррекции.

📊 Какая у вас конфигурация 1С?
Управление торговлей (УТ)
Розница (Розница)
Бухгалтерия предприятия (БП)
УНФ
Другая конфигурация

После заполнения всех полей необходимо выполнить команду Тестирование оборудования. Система попытается запросить у кассы текущее состояние фискального накопителя и версию прошивки. Если тест пройден успешно, статус кассы изменится на «Подключено», и она будет готова к регистрации чеков продаж.

Обмен данными с сайтом и внешними сервисами

Часто под фразой «выгрузить данные» пользователи подразумевают необходимость передать информацию о продажах с кассы на сайт интернет-магазина или, наоборот, получить заказы из сайта в 1С для их последующей фискализации. Этот процесс реализуется через механизмы обмена данными, которые могут быть как встроенными в конфигурацию, так и реализованными через сторонние модули.

Для организации обмена используется технология веб-сервисов или прямая работа с базой данных через ODBC/JDBC. В современных версиях 1С наиболее распространенным методом является использование HTTP-сервисов. Касса, подключенная к 1С, выступает в роли клиента, который отправляет запросы на сервер или принимает команды на печать чека при оформлении заказа на сайте.

Параметр обмена Описание Частота обновления
Остатки товаров Передача актуального количества на складе Каждые 15-30 минут
Заказы покупателей Выгрузка новых заказов с сайта в 1С По событию или раз в 5 минут
Статусы заказов Отправка статуса (собран, отгружен) на сайт Мгновенно при изменении
Фискальные чеки Передача данных о пробитом чеке в ОФД В реальном времени

Настройка правил обмена требует тщательного сопоставления полей данных. Например, номенклатура на сайте и в 1С должна иметь одинаковые идентификаторы (GUID) или артикулы, иначе система не сможет понять, какой именно товар был продан. Для этого часто используют таблицы соответствия или скрипты преобразования данных.

⚠️ Внимание: При настройке обмена через интернет убедитесь, что порты сервера открыты для входящих соединений, и настроен SSL-сертификат. Передача фискальных данных по незащищенному каналу HTTP запрещена требованиями безопасности ПДн.

Важно также настроить обработку ошибок. Если связь с сайтом прервется, данные о продажах не должны потеряться. В 1С предусмотрены механизмы очередей сообщений, где документы сохраняются до момента восстановления соединения и последующей успешной отправки.

Выгрузка отчетов и работа с фискальным накопителем

Регулярная выгрузка отчетов о продажах и состоянии расчетов — обязательная часть работы кассира и бухгалтера. В 1С эти отчеты формируются на основе данных, полученных непосредственно из фискального накопителя (ФН). Это гарантирует достоверность информации, так как она берется из защищенной памяти устройства, которую невозможно задним числом изменить.

Для получения отчета необходимо воспользоваться обработкой Отчеты по ККТ, которая находится в разделе продаж или в специальном рабочем месте кассира. Пользователь выбирает период, тип отчета (например, «Отчет о состоянии расчетов» или «Отчет о закрытии смены») и инициирует чтение данных с устройства. Программа отправляет команду на кассу, считывает байтовый поток и декодирует его в понятный табличный вид.

☑️ Проверка перед закрытием смены

Выполнено: 0 / 4

Особое внимание стоит уделить отчету Z-отчет (Отчет о закрытии смены). Он фиксирует итоговые продажи за день и обнуляет суточные счетчики. Выгрузить эти данные в 1С нужно до конца операционного дня, чтобы корректно закрыть кассовую смену и в учетной системе. Расхождение между данными Z-отчета и данными в документе «Отчет кассира» в 1С является сигналом о проблемах в учете.

Также через интерфейс 1С можно выгрузить детализированные данные о каждом пробитом чеке за любой период. Это полезно для анализа продаж, работы с возвратами или при проведении инвентаризации. Данные экспортируются в популярные форматы, такие как Excel или CSV, для дальнейшей обработки во внешних аналитических системах.

Типичные ошибки и способы их устранения

В процессе эксплуатации связки «1С — ККТ» пользователи часто сталкиваются с типовыми ошибками, которые могут остановить торговый процесс. Понимание причин их возникновения позволяет быстро восстановить работоспособность системы без вызова сервисного инженера. Большинство проблем связано с драйверами, правами доступа или некорректными данными в чеке.

Одна из самых частых ошибок — «Не найдено устройство» или «Порт занят». Это означает, что 1С не может установить соединение с кассой. Причиной может быть физическое отключение кабеля, смена COM-порта системой после перезагрузки или блокировка порта антивирусом. Решение заключается в переподключении кабеля и проверке настроек порта в драйвере ККТ.

Другая распространенная проблема — ошибка фискализации, например, «Переполнение ФН» или «Срок действия ключа фискализации истек». В этом случае выгрузка данных невозможна до замены фискального накопителя. 1С предупредит об этом заранее, но игнорирование предупреждений может привести к блокировке кассы.

Что делать при ошибке "Неверная сумма чека"?

Эта ошибка возникает, если сумма товаров в чеке не совпадает с переданной суммой оплаты. Проверьте, чтобы в документе продажи в 1С были указаны правильные способы оплаты (наличный/безналичный) и их суммы в точности соответствовали тому, что вводится в кассу. Даже расхождение в 1 копейку вызовет ошибку фискального накопителя.

Ошибки при обмене с сайтом часто связаны с несоответствием форматов данных. Если сайт передает товар, которого нет в справочнике номенклатуры 1С, или передает цену с большим количеством знаков после запятой, чем разрешено настройками точности, процесс выгрузки прервется. Логирование обмена помогает точно определить, на каком этапе и с каким документом возникла проблема.

Автоматизация и мониторинг состояния касс

Для крупных торговых сетей или магазинов с высоким трафиком ручная выгрузка данных и контроль состояния касс становятся неэффективными. В таких случаях рекомендуется внедрять системы автоматического мониторинга. Конфигурации 1С позволяют настроить регламентные задания, которые будут в фоновом режиме опрашивать кассы и собирать статистику.

С помощью обработки Монитор касс администратор может видеть статус всех подключенных устройств в реальном времени: открыта ли смена, сколько места осталось в ФН, есть ли ошибки печати. Это позволяет предотвращать простои, заранее заказывая замену ленты или фискального накопителя.

💡

Настройте отправку уведомлений в Telegram или на электронную почту при возникновении критических ошибок на кассе. Это позволит реагировать на проблемы мгновенно, даже если вы находитесь не в магазине.

Автоматизация также касается процесса закрытия смен. Можно настроить сценарий, при котором 1С автоматически формирует документ закрытия смены в определенное время и отправляет команду на кассу. Это исключает человеческий фактор и риск забыть закрыть смену, что чревато штрафами.

Регулярный анализ логов обмена данными помогает выявлять скрытые проблемы, такие как периодические обрывы связи или замедление работы базы данных при больших объемах выгрузки. Оптимизация этих процессов обеспечивает стабильную работу магазина даже в пиковые часы распродаж.

💡

Стабильная работа интеграции 1С и ККТ зависит не только от правильной настройки драйверов, но и от регулярного мониторинга состояния фискального накопителя и качества интернет-соединения.

Нужно ли перепрошивать кассу при обновлении 1С?

В большинстве случаев перепрошивка самой кассы не требуется при обновлении платформы 1С. Достаточно обновить драйвер ККТ и внешнюю обработку подключения. Однако, если в новой версии 1С появились требования к новым форматам фискальных данных (ФФД), которые ваша текущая прошивка кассы не поддерживает, тогда обновление прошивки кассы станет обязательным.

Как выгрузить данные, если касса не подключена к компьютеру?

Если касса автономна и не подключена к ПК с 1С напрямую, выгрузить данные можно через облачный сервис производителя кассы или через ОФД. Многие современные кассы имеют встроенный Wi-Fi и передают данные в личный кабинет производителя, откуда их можно выгрузить в формате CSV/XML и загрузить в 1С через специальную обработку импорта.

Что делать, если данные в 1С и на кассе расходятся?

Расхождение данных — серьезная проблема. Сначала сверьте журналы документов в 1С с бумажными или электронными копиями чеков. Если ошибка в 1С (например, забыли провести документ), восстановите его вручную. Если ошибка в кассе (пробили лишний чек), необходимо пробить чек коррекции или чек возврата, строго следуя инструкциям ФНС, чтобы выровнять итоги.

Можно ли выгрузить данные из архива ФН?

Да, данные из архива фискального накопителя можно выгрузить, даже если смена уже закрыта давно. Для этого в драйвере ККТ или в 1С используется команда чтения данных из ФН по диапазону дат или номеров документов. Это часто требуется при налоговых проверках или аудите за прошлые периоды.

Влияет ли скорость интернета на выгрузку данных в 1С?

Скорость интернета влияет только на передачу данных в ОФД и облачные сервисы. Непосредственная выгрузка данных с кассы в 1С по локальному кабелю (USB/COM) от интернета не зависит. Однако, если используется сетевая касса или облачная интеграция с сайтом, то стабильность канала связи критически важна для скорости обмена.